The Warriors are...(Are you ready for this?)...CATS! eek razz Yep, the cats live in four separate clans in the forest and have alliances and wars and whatnot. It's actually quite intense for a children's series. The author isn't afraid to kill off characters, have descriptive battles, and make characters lose their sanity.

Well, I should say the authors. 'Erin Hunter' is really three different women. Two of them write the books and the third makes sure that the books are consistent so that the writing style is the same.

Anyway, it's a very good series. i wouldn't say it's one of the best ones in the entire world, but it's definitely an original and well-written children's series.
